XX

by Ambrose Bierce

From Standard Ebooks · standardebooks/ambrose-bierce_poetry

Here lies Joseph Redding, who gave us the catfish. He dined upon every fish except that fish. ’Twas touching to hear him expounding his fad With a heart full of zeal and a mouth full of shad. The catfish meowed with unspeakable woe When Death, the lone fisherman, landed their Jo.
